MONTICELLO POLICE DEPARTMENT PRESS RELEASE

Shooting investigation

Posted

MONTICELLO, NY — At 6:58 p.m. on Tuesday, January 4, Monticello police responded to a 911 call reporting a shooting at 377 East Broadway in the Village of Monticello. Monticello officers arrived on the scene within one minute and located 37-year-old male bleeding from a gunshot wound to his right thigh. The victim was transported to Garnet Health Catskill Medical Center in Harris by Mobile Medic Ambulance.  

The victim of the shooting was interviewed at the hospital and is refusing to cooperate in the investigation. The suspects were described as two males wearing all-black clothing and black face masks. Anyone with information about this incident can call Monticello Police in confidence at 845/794-4422. 

Assisting Monticello police at the scene were New York State Police and Sullivan County Sheriff Deputies.
